1990 Alfa Romeo Spider vs. 2004 Chrysler Sebring
To start off, 2004 Chrysler Sebring is newer by 14 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ider would be higher. At 2,735 cc (6 cylinders), 2004 Chrysler Sebring is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Chrysler Sebring (200 HP @ 6400 RPM) has 80 more horse power than 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ider. (120 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Chrysler Sebring should accelerate faster than 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Chrysler Sebring weights approximately 416 kg more than 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2004 Chrysler Sebring (258 Nm) has 101 more torque (in Nm) than 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ider. (157 Nm). This means 2004 Chrysler Sebring will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1990 Alfa Romeo Spider.
Compare all specifications:
1990 Alfa Romeo Spider | 2004 Chrysler Sebring |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Chrysler |
Model | Spider | Sebring |
Year Released | 1990 | 2004 |
Body Type | Roadster |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1962 cc | 2735 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 120 HP | 200 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 6400 RPM |
Torque | 157 Nm | 258 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 84.1 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 88.5 mm | 78 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 9.9:1 |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1160 kg | 1576 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4270 mm | 4930 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1630 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1300 mm | 1400 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2260 mm | 2620 mm |
